As health and local authority partners move towards neighbourhood working what does that mean for the voluntary sector in Reading?

Neighbourhood working is about bringing health, social care, voluntary and community organisations together to improve the wellbeing of local people. By focusing on the strengths and needs of each community, services will be more joined-up, proactive, and responsive.

What are the priorities for your community and beneficiaries? What resources, partnerships and pathways are needed to ensure the voluntary sector is an equal and included partner?
